本文将揭示H5特效背后的秘密,介绍其制作过程中所使用的技术和工具。通过深入了解这些特效的制作原理和方法,读者可以更好地理解H5特效的实现过程,掌握相关技能,从而制作出更加生动、吸引人的H5页面。本文将介绍一些常用的制作工具和技术,包括动画设计、交互设计等方面的内容。无论你是初学者还是专业人士,本文都将为你提供有价值的参考和帮助。
本文目录导读:
随着移动互联网的飞速发展,H5页面特效因其丰富的交互体验和视觉冲击力,成为了众多企业和开发者争相追捧的热点技术,H5特效究竟用什么做呢?本文将带你深入了解H5特效的制作工具和核心技术。
H5特效制作工具
1、HTML5:作为构建H5页面的基础语言,HTML5提供了丰富的标签和API,使得开发者可以轻松地创建具有各种特效的页面。
2、CSS3:通过CSS3的样式设计,我们可以实现页面元素的样式美化、动画效果以及布局调整,CSS3的过渡、变形和动画属性为H5页面提供了丰富的视觉效果。
3、JavaScript及框架:JavaScript是实现H5页面交互功能的关键,借助诸如React、Vue等前端框架,我们可以更高效地开发复杂的H5特效。
4、第三方库和插件:为了简化开发过程,许多第三方库和插件如jQuery、Three.js等被广泛应用于实现各种复杂的H5特效。
核心技术解析
1、响应式设计:随着移动设备种类繁多,屏幕尺寸各异,响应式设计成为了H5特效的核心技术之一,通过响应式设计,我们可以确保H5页面在各种设备上都能呈现出最佳的视觉效果。
2、动画与过渡效果:CSS3的动画和过渡效果为H5页面带来了丰富的视觉体验,结合JavaScript,我们可以实现更加复杂的动画效果,提升用户的交互体验。
3、WebGL技术:WebGL技术可以在浏览器中实现三维图形渲染,为H5页面带来更加逼真的动画效果和交互体验,借助Three.js等JavaScript库,我们可以更方便地利用WebGL技术实现复杂的H5特效。
4、跨平台兼容性:为了实现H5页面在各种浏览器和设备上的兼容,我们需要关注不同平台的特性,采用合适的技巧和工具进行适配,使用Modernizr等工具检测浏览器对HTML5和CSS3的支持情况,以确保H5页面的兼容性。
5、性能优化:为了实现流畅的H5特效体验,我们需要关注页面的性能优化,通过压缩代码、减少HTTP请求、使用CDN等方式提高页面的加载速度;通过优化动画、避免过度绘制等方式提高页面的运行性能。
6、交互设计:H5特效的魅力在于其丰富的交互体验,我们需要根据用户需求和行为习惯,设计出合理的交互流程,提升用户的参与度和满意度。
实践应用与案例分析
1、电商类H5页面:通过运用各种H5特效,如轮播图、弹窗、动态按钮等,提升页面的视觉效果和用户体验,某电商平台的促销活动页面,通过运用CSS3动画和JavaScript交互,吸引用户参与活动。
2、社交娱乐类H5页面:社交娱乐类H5页面需要丰富的交互体验和视觉冲击力,通过运用WebGL技术、第三方库和插件等,实现更加逼真的动画效果和交互体验,提升用户的参与度和粘性。
3、企业宣传类H5页面:企业宣传类H5页面需要展示企业的形象和实力,通过运用响应式设计、动画过渡效果等,打造具有品牌特色的H5页面,提升企业的知名度和美誉度。
H5特效的制作离不开HTML5、CSS3、JavaScript等基础技术,以及第三方库和插件的支持,我们还需要关注响应式设计、动画过渡效果、WebGL技术、跨平台兼容性、性能优化和交互设计等方面的核心技术,通过实践应用,我们可以将这些技术运用于电商、社交娱乐和企业宣传等场景,提升页面的视觉效果和用户体验。